What is Independence Plus?
Independence Plus, established in 1987, is a dedicated provider of skilled at-home healthcare and essential medical equipment. The company empowers individuals to maintain fulfilling lives within their own residences by offering a comprehensive suite of services. These include skilled hourly home nursing, vital home health visits, and the provision of respiratory home medical equipment, all meticulously tailored to meet the unique requirements of both patients and their caregivers.
Operating at the intersection of healthcare delivery and patient well-being, Independence Plus actively collaborates with healthcare facilities and insurance providers. This strategic alignment aims to ensure the delivery of high-quality care, with a key objective of reducing hospital readmissions and improving overall patient outcomes. Their professional team is committed to delivering personalized care and robust support during the critical transition to home-based health services.
